Definition ∞ Non-EVM chains are blockchain networks that do not utilize the Ethereum Virtual Machine for smart contract execution. These networks employ distinct virtual machines or execution environments tailored to their specific architectural designs. This differentiation can lead to unique functionalities and performance characteristics.
Context ∞ Developments concerning non-EVM chains often highlight advancements in their native programming languages, consensus mechanisms, or interoperability solutions with EVM-compatible networks. The ongoing competition and innovation in this space contribute to a more diverse blockchain landscape.
